US Ends Electric Vehicle Tax Credits, Slowing EV Market Growth

The US Congress ended $7,500 tax credits for new electric vehicles and $4,000 credits for used EVs on September 30th, potentially slowing EV market growth and benefiting automakers by eliminating fuel economy penalties; a Harvard study forecasts a 6% reduction in EV penetration by 2030 due to this.

140+ EPA Employees Suspended After Criticizing Trump-Era Policy Shifts

Over 140 EPA employees were suspended for two weeks with pay following a letter signed by over 270 employees criticizing the agency's shift under the Trump administration, which includes cuts to funding for poor communities, rollbacks of air pollution regulations, and the reversal of an asbestos ban...

EU's Weakening Climate Action Momentum Amidst Geopolitical Shifts

A shift in the EU's priorities from climate action to economic competitiveness and the Russia-Ukraine conflict has weakened the momentum on climate change, despite 85 percent of Europeans being worried about it, leading to a more pragmatic approach to emissions reduction targets.

Italy Under Extreme Heatwave: Two Deaths and 17 Cities on Red Alert

Extreme heat and heavy rains hit Italy, causing two deaths and leading to 17 cities under red alert, while yellow alerts were issued in three regions due to intense rainfall; climatologists warn that without global warming mitigation, such summers will become the norm.

Greek Wildfires Under Control After Evacuations and Property Damage

Wildfires near Athens and on Crete, fueled by strong winds and dry conditions, have been brought under control, resulting in evacuations, property damage, and disruptions to tourism; two deaths were reported in neighboring Turkey due to separate wildfires.

International Coral Crossbreeding Aims to Save Miami Reef

Off the coast of Miami, scientists are transplanting crossbred coral fragments from Florida and Honduras onto a bleached reef to increase heat tolerance, marking the first international coral crossbreeding for wild reef restoration and offering potential solutions for global coral reef conservation.

Western Balkans Drought Cripples Agriculture, Electricity, and Water Supplies

Extreme heat and drought caused by an African anticyclone affect the Western Balkans, impacting agriculture, electricity production (Albania imported €60 million in energy in H1 2024), and water resources, leading to restrictions and the closure of Pristina's Gërmia pool.

EPA Suspends 139 Employees for Dissent Over Environmental Policy Rollbacks

On Thursday, the EPA placed 139 employees on administrative leave for signing a letter criticizing the agency's weakening environmental policies under Administrator Lee Zeldin, which include funding cuts estimated to cost 30,000 lives and $275 billion annually.

Germany's Solar Energy Expansion Slows, Raising 2030 Target Concerns

Germany's solar energy expansion has reached 107.5 gigawatts of installed capacity by mid-2024, halfway towards the 2030 target of 215 gigawatts; however, the recent slowdown in expansion raises concerns about achieving this goal.

Wildfires Force Evacuations in Greece and Turkey, Claiming Two Lives

Wildfires forced thousands to evacuate resorts in Crete, Greece, and caused at least two deaths in Turkey, highlighting the impact of extreme heat and strong winds exacerbated by climate change.

Trump Signs "One Big Beautiful Bill", Prioritizing Border Security, Tax Cuts, and Military Spending

President Trump signed the "One Big Beautiful Bill", allocating $178 billion to border security, $153 billion to military spending, implementing significant tax cuts, and reducing social programs and international aid, prioritizing a domestically focused "America First" agenda.
